Because Alzheimer's and dementia are diseases of memory loss,
physical design of living space is integral to a balanced life. Kipling
Manor can provide a
smaller, more personal space which helps decrease anxiety, confusion and
depression so our residents with advanced Alzheimer's/Dementia are secure in their own
area of our facility. They have their own common area, staff and a
secure patio/fenced outside area for them to enjoy the outdoors in a safe
environment. Customized care helps residents participate in their own lives
and provides opportunities to succeed in areas where the resident can
still perform. As people with Alzheimer's and dementia lose the ability to
learn new things, reaffirming their independence contributes to improved
self esteem and mentally stimulates them. Activities also
help residents feel important and needed.
